若有以下說明和語句:
struct student{
int age;
int num;
}std, *p;
p=&std;
則下面對該結構體變量std中成員age的引用方式錯誤的是()。
A.std.age
B.*p.age
C.(*p).age
D.p->age
您可能感興趣的試卷
你可能感興趣的試題
若有下列函數定義:
setw(int *x,int m,int n,int data)
{ int k;
for(k=0;k
}
}
則調用此函數的正確寫法是(假設變量的說明為int a[50];)()。
A.setw(*a,5,8,1);
B.setw(&a,5,8,1);
C.setw((int*)a,5,8,1);
D.setw(a,5,8,1);
若已有以下定義和語句:
#include
int x=4,y=3,*p,*q,*s;
p=&x; q=&y; s=q; q=NULL;
則下面分別給出的四條語句中,錯誤的是()
A.*q=0;
B.s=p;
C.*p=x;
D.*p=*s;
A.char *str= “good!”;
B.char str[]= “good!”;
C.char str[5]= {‘g’,‘o’,‘o’,‘d’};
D.char str[5]= “good!”;
A.*p+9
B.*(p+8)
C.*p+=9
D.p+8
A.p是一個指向double類型變量的指針
B.p是double類型數組
C.p是指針數組
D.p是數組指針

最新試題
建立多級目錄的目的是()
鏈表不具備的特點是()。
實現虛擬存貯技術主要的硬件支持是DMA技術及大容量的輔存如硬盤。
虛擬段式存儲管理中,若邏輯地址的段內地址大于段表中該段的段長,則發(fā)生地址越界中斷。
如圖所示,C節(jié)點的度為(),樹的度為()。
若表R再排序前已經按關鍵字值遞增排列,則()算法的比較次數最少。
從理論上,計算機系統(tǒng)的虛擬存儲空間的大小是由()確定的。
請設計一C語言函數(注:只要求寫出該函數,不要求寫出完整程序),該函數的功能是將一個int類型的數組A[0..n-1]的所有元素循環(huán)右移k個位置。 例如,對于某數組,當k=3(即把數組所有元素循環(huán)右移3位)時,是將
下面是生產者與消費者進程的算法描述,請分析進程中,兩個P操作和兩個V操作是否可以交換?為什么?
文件的邏輯結構是指文件在存儲空間的分配方式。